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, long-lasting roofing systems using natural slate tiles. This process typically includes preparing the roof structure, selecting appropriate slate materials, and carefully installing each tile to ensure a secure and weather-resistant surface. Professional contractors often pay close attention to the precise placement of each slate piece, along with proper flashing and underlayment, to maximize the roof’s longevity and aesthetic appeal. The result is a classic, elegant roof that can enhance the architectural character of a property and provide reliable protection against the elements.

These services address common roofing problems such as leaks, deteriorating shingles, and structural damage caused by weather exposure over time. Slate roofs are known for their resistance to moisture, fire, and pests, which can help prevent costly repairs and extensive damage in the long run. Proper installation also reduces the risk of water infiltration and ensures that the roof maintains its integrity through various weather conditions. By relying on experienced professionals, property owners can mitigate issues related to aging or damaged roofing materials and extend the lifespan of their roof.

Properties that often utilize slate roof construction include historic homes, upscale residential buildings, and certain commercial properties with distinctive architectural styles. These roofs are particularly valued for their aesthetic qualities, which complement traditional and period-specific designs. Additionally, slate roofing is favored in regions where durability and low maintenance are priorities, such as areas prone to severe weather or where long-term investment in building materials is desired. The versatility of slate allows it to be adapted to various roof shapes and sizes, making it suitable for a wide range of property types.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Evanston,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Design Costs - Slate roof construction typically ranges from $30 to $50 per square foot, with total costs depending on roof size and complexity. For example, a 1,500-square-foot roof may cost between $45,000 and $75,000. Variations depend on the type of slate and design features.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a slate roof usually fall between $10,000 and $20,000 for an average-sized home. These costs can vary based on the roof’s pitch, accessibility, and local labor rates. Complex or custom designs may increase labor expenses.

Additional Materials and Accessories - Extra costs for underlayment, flashing, and other materials can add approximately 10-15% to the overall project. For example, these may amount to $5,000 to $10,000 depending on the scope of work and material choices.

Project Size and Roof Complexity - Larger or more intricate roofs tend to increase overall costs, with projects exceeding 2,000 square feet potentially reaching $100,000 or more. Costs vary based on roof shape, number of dormers, and other architectural features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of a slate roof?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for homeowners seeking a lasting roofing solution.

How is a slate roof installed? Installation involves carefully placing individual slate tiles onto a suitable roof deck, ensuring proper alignment and secure fastening by experienced local contractors.

What maintenance is required for a slate roof? Regular inspections and cleaning of debris help maintain the integrity of a slate roof, with repairs performed by local pros to address any damaged or loose tiles.

Can a slate roof be repaired if damaged? Yes, local roofing specialists can replace or repair damaged slate tiles to preserve the roof's appearance and function.

How long does a slate roof typically last? When properly maintained, a slate roof can last over a century, with local pros providing services to help extend its lifespan.
